Usages of der Kellner
Der Kellner bringt die Speisekarte.
The waiter brings the menu.
Später bitte ich den Kellner um die Rechnung.
Later I ask the waiter for the bill.
Ich bin allergisch, deshalb frage ich den Kellner nach den Zutaten.
I am allergic, so I ask the waiter about the ingredients.
Wegen meiner Allergie frage ich den Kellner nach der Zutatenliste.
Because of my allergy, I ask the waiter for the ingredient list.

“How do German cases work?”
German has four grammatical cases: nominative (subject), accusative (direct object), dative (indirect object), and genitive (possession). The case determines the form of articles and adjectives. For example, "the dog" is "der Hund" as a subject but "den Hund" as a direct object.
